這是爲什麼?

如果在該行上得到NullPointerException,則只有一種可能的解釋。這就是clientOutputStreamnull

的例外是不是因爲uname值的發生。通過null的行爲不會,也不能扔NullPointerException。事實上,將null寫入ObjectOutputStream是完全有效的。

你的下一個步驟應該是:

  1. 確認clientOutputStreamnull在這一點上,然後,

  2. 找出它爲什麼是null

你的代碼相當太長「通過目測調試」,但它看起來就像當你在main(...)調用getConnections()那場應設置。也許我失去了一些東西......


1 - 有一種情況你傳遞一個null,而不是在上下文中的彩盒包裝基本類型,其中方法需要原始類型的邊緣情況。在這種情況下,拆箱將拋出一個NullPointerException。那看起來像是 NPE正在進行調用的行爲,但事實上它正在隱藏拆箱操作中發生。
